August 22, 8 PM
Ariel Pink, Los Angeles’ king of low-fi and freak-folk, is returning to Russia with his latest, eleventh studio album, Dedicated to Bobby Jameson (adjudged best new album by Pitchfork), which he will perform in concert with a full band on New Holland’s main stage on August 22.
